skoinfo.rfc.board.action
Class BoardAction

java.lang.Object
  extended by com.opensymphony.xwork2.ActionSupport
      extended by skoinfo.rfc.common.action.AbstractAction
          extended by skoinfo.rfc.board.action.BoardAction
All Implemented Interfaces:
com.opensymphony.xwork2.Action, com.opensymphony.xwork2.LocaleProvider, com.opensymphony.xwork2.ModelDriven, com.opensymphony.xwork2.Preparable, com.opensymphony.xwork2.TextProvider, com.opensymphony.xwork2.Validateable, com.opensymphony.xwork2.ValidationAware, java.io.Serializable, org.apache.struts2.interceptor.ServletRequestAware, org.apache.struts2.interceptor.ServletResponseAware

public class BoardAction
extends AbstractAction
implements com.opensymphony.xwork2.Preparable, com.opensymphony.xwork2.ModelDriven, org.apache.struts2.interceptor.ServletRequestAware, org.apache.struts2.interceptor.ServletResponseAware

Author:
sollogs
See Also:
Serialized Form

Field Summary
 
Fields inherited from interface com.opensymphony.xwork2.Action
ERROR, INPUT, LOGIN, NONE, SUCCESS
 
Constructor Summary
BoardAction()
           
 
Method Summary
 java.lang.String boardRestoreAct()
          게시판스킨 복원하기 Action [원서형 : 2009-10-29]
 java.lang.String deleteBoardAct()
          게시판 삭제 처리 Action
 int deleteBoardAdmin(long adminSid)
          게시판 관리자 삭제하기
 java.util.List<BoardBackUpVO> getBoardBackUpList(java.lang.String groupCd, java.lang.String boardSid, java.lang.String layerId, java.lang.String count)
          게시판스킨 가져오기 [원서형 : 2009-10-28]
 BoardBackUpVO getBoardBackUpVO()
           
 long getBoardBpSid()
           
 BoardVO getBoardDefaultSkinInfo(java.lang.String skinFileName, java.lang.String boardSelect)
          게시판 기본 스킨 정보 가져오기
 java.util.List<BoardVO> getBoardList(java.lang.String groupCd)
          해당 그룹에 해당하는 게시판 가져오기
 BoardVO getBoardVO()
          BoardVO getter
 java.util.List<BoardVO> getBoardVOList()
          boardVOList getter
 java.lang.String getCommand()
          command getter
 java.lang.String getKeyword()
           keyword getter
 java.lang.String getLayerId()
           
 java.lang.Object getModel()
          Model-Driven Interceptor
 java.lang.String getOrderField()
           
 java.lang.String getOrderSort()
           
 int getPageBlock()
           pageBlock getter
 int getPageSize()
           pageSize getter
 Paging getPaging()
          Pageing getter
 java.lang.String getSearchType()
           searchType getter
 long getSrcBoardSid()
           
 int getStartPage()
          startPage getter
 int insertBoardAdminList(long boardSid, java.lang.String userId)
          게시판 관리자 추가 및 가져오기
 java.lang.String listBoard()
          게시판 목록 Action
 void prepare()
          Prepare Interceptor
 java.lang.String restoreView()
          스킨백업 보기 Action
 java.lang.String saveOrigBoardAct()
          게시판 스킨 백업하기 [원서형 : 2009-10-28]
 void setBoardBackUpVO(BoardBackUpVO boardBackUpVO)
           
 void setBoardBpSid(long boardBpSid)
           
 void setBoardVO(BoardVO boardVO)
          BoardVO setter
 void setBoardVOList(java.util.List<BoardVO> boardVOList)
          boardVOList getter
 void setCommand(java.lang.String command)
          command setter
 void setKeyword(java.lang.String keyword)
           keyword setter
 void setLayerId(java.lang.String layerId)
           
 void setOrderField(java.lang.String orderField)
           
 void setOrderSort(java.lang.String orderSort)
           
 void setSearchType(java.lang.String searchType)
           searchType setter
 void setServletRequest(javax.servlet.http.HttpServletRequest request)
           HttpServletRequest setter
 void setServletResponse(javax.servlet.http.HttpServletResponse response)
           HttpServletResponse setter
 void setSrcBoardSid(long srcBoardSid)
           
 void setStartPage(int startPage)
          startPage setter
 java.lang.String skinCopyAct()
           
 java.lang.String updateBoard()
          게시판 수정 Action
 java.lang.String updateBoardAct()
          게시판 수정 처리 Action
 java.lang.String updateBoardConfig()
          게시판 환경 설정 Action
 java.lang.String updateBoardConfigAct()
          게시판 환경 설정 Action
 java.lang.String updateBoardSkin()
          게시판 스킨 Action
 java.lang.String updateBoardSkinAct()
          게시판 스킨 수정 처리 Action
 java.lang.String viewBoard()
          게시판 상세보기
 java.lang.String writeBoard()
          게시판 등록 Action
 java.lang.String writeBoardAct()
          게시판 등록 처리 Action BOARD':'일반형' --미사용 'GALLERY':'갤러리형' --미사용 'NEWS':'펼침형' --미사용 'WSS_BOARD':'(웹접근성)일반형' 'WSS_GALLERY':'(웹접근성)갤러리형' 'WSS_NEWS':'(웹접근성)펼침형
 
Methods inherited from class skoinfo.rfc.common.action.AbstractAction
getText, getText, getText, getText, getText, getText, getText, getText, getText, getTexts, getTexts
 
Methods inherited from class com.opensymphony.xwork2.ActionSupport
addActionError, addActionMessage, addFieldError, clearActionErrors, clearErrors, clearErrorsAndMessages, clearFieldErrors, clearMessages, clone, doDefault, execute, getActionErrors, getActionMessages, getErrorMessages, getErrors, getFieldErrors, getLocale, hasActionErrors, hasActionMessages, hasErrors, hasFieldErrors, hasKey, input, pause, setActionErrors, setActionMessages, setFieldErrors, validate
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

BoardAction

public BoardAction()
Method Detail

prepare

public void prepare()
             throws java.lang.Exception
Prepare Interceptor

Specified by:
prepare in interface com.opensymphony.xwork2.Preparable
Throws:
java.lang.Exception

getModel

public java.lang.Object getModel()
Model-Driven Interceptor

Specified by:
getModel in interface com.opensymphony.xwork2.ModelDriven

listBoard

public java.lang.String listBoard()
                           throws java.lang.Exception
게시판 목록 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

writeBoard

public java.lang.String writeBoard()
                            throws java.lang.Exception
게시판 등록 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

updateBoard

public java.lang.String updateBoard()
                             throws java.lang.Exception
게시판 수정 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

updateBoardSkin

public java.lang.String updateBoardSkin()
                                 throws java.lang.Exception
게시판 스킨 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

updateBoardConfig

public java.lang.String updateBoardConfig()
                                   throws java.lang.Exception
게시판 환경 설정 Action

Returns:
String
Throws:
java.lang.Exception

viewBoard

public java.lang.String viewBoard()
                           throws java.lang.Exception
게시판 상세보기

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

writeBoardAct

public java.lang.String writeBoardAct()
                               throws java.lang.Exception
게시판 등록 처리 Action BOARD':'일반형' --미사용 'GALLERY':'갤러리형' --미사용 'NEWS':'펼침형' --미사용 'WSS_BOARD':'(웹접근성)일반형' 'WSS_GALLERY':'(웹접근성)갤러리형' 'WSS_NEWS':'(웹접근성)펼침형

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

saveOrigBoardAct

public java.lang.String saveOrigBoardAct()
                                  throws java.lang.Exception
게시판 스킨 백업하기 [원서형 : 2009-10-28]

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

getBoardBackUpList

public java.util.List<BoardBackUpVO> getBoardBackUpList(java.lang.String groupCd,
                                                        java.lang.String boardSid,
                                                        java.lang.String layerId,
                                                        java.lang.String count)
                                                 throws java.lang.Exception
게시판스킨 가져오기 [원서형 : 2009-10-28]

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

restoreView

public java.lang.String restoreView()
                             throws java.lang.Exception
스킨백업 보기 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

updateBoardAct

public java.lang.String updateBoardAct()
                                throws java.lang.Exception
게시판 수정 처리 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

boardRestoreAct

public java.lang.String boardRestoreAct()
                                 throws java.lang.Exception
게시판스킨 복원하기 Action [원서형 : 2009-10-29]

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

updateBoardSkinAct

public java.lang.String updateBoardSkinAct()
                                    throws java.lang.Exception
게시판 스킨 수정 처리 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

updateBoardConfigAct

public java.lang.String updateBoardConfigAct()
                                      throws java.lang.Exception
게시판 환경 설정 Action

Returns:
String
Throws:
java.lang.Exception

deleteBoardAct

public java.lang.String deleteBoardAct()
                                throws java.lang.Exception
게시판 삭제 처리 Action

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

skinCopyAct

public java.lang.String skinCopyAct()
                             throws java.lang.Exception
Throws:
java.lang.Exception

getBoardList

public java.util.List<BoardVO> getBoardList(java.lang.String groupCd)
                                     throws java.lang.Exception
해당 그룹에 해당하는 게시판 가져오기

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

getBoardDefaultSkinInfo

public BoardVO getBoardDefaultSkinInfo(java.lang.String skinFileName,
                                       java.lang.String boardSelect)
                                throws java.lang.Exception
게시판 기본 스킨 정보 가져오기

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

insertBoardAdminList

public int insertBoardAdminList(long boardSid,
                                java.lang.String userId)
                         throws java.lang.Exception
게시판 관리자 추가 및 가져오기

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

deleteBoardAdmin

public int deleteBoardAdmin(long adminSid)
                     throws java.lang.Exception
게시판 관리자 삭제하기

Returns:
처리 결과를 리턴한다.
Throws:
java.lang.Exception - 처리

setServletRequest

public void setServletRequest(javax.servlet.http.HttpServletRequest request)

HttpServletRequest setter

Specified by:
setServletRequest in interface org.apache.struts2.interceptor.ServletRequestAware

setServletResponse

public void setServletResponse(javax.servlet.http.HttpServletResponse response)

HttpServletResponse setter

Specified by:
setServletResponse in interface org.apache.struts2.interceptor.ServletResponseAware

getKeyword

public java.lang.String getKeyword()

keyword getter


setKeyword

public void setKeyword(java.lang.String keyword)

keyword setter


getSearchType

public java.lang.String getSearchType()

searchType getter


setSearchType

public void setSearchType(java.lang.String searchType)

searchType setter


setCommand

public void setCommand(java.lang.String command)
command setter

Parameters:
command - parameter

getCommand

public java.lang.String getCommand()
command getter

Returns:
command parameter

setStartPage

public void setStartPage(int startPage)
startPage setter

Parameters:
startPage - parameter

getStartPage

public int getStartPage()
startPage getter

Returns:
startPage parameter

getBoardVO

public BoardVO getBoardVO()
BoardVO getter

Returns:
command parameter

setBoardVO

public void setBoardVO(BoardVO boardVO)
BoardVO setter

Parameters:
boardVO - parameter

getPaging

public Paging getPaging()
Pageing getter

Returns:
Pageing

setBoardVOList

public void setBoardVOList(java.util.List<BoardVO> boardVOList)
boardVOList getter

Parameters:
List -

getBoardVOList

public java.util.List<BoardVO> getBoardVOList()
boardVOList getter

Returns:
List

setSrcBoardSid

public void setSrcBoardSid(long srcBoardSid)
Parameters:
srcBoardSid -

getSrcBoardSid

public long getSrcBoardSid()
Returns:

getPageSize

public int getPageSize()

pageSize getter


getPageBlock

public int getPageBlock()

pageBlock getter


getLayerId

public java.lang.String getLayerId()
Returns:

setLayerId

public void setLayerId(java.lang.String layerId)
Parameters:
layerId -

getOrderField

public java.lang.String getOrderField()
Returns:

setOrderField

public void setOrderField(java.lang.String orderField)
Parameters:
orderField -

getOrderSort

public java.lang.String getOrderSort()
Returns:

setOrderSort

public void setOrderSort(java.lang.String orderSort)
Parameters:
orderSort -

getBoardBpSid

public long getBoardBpSid()
Returns:

setBoardBpSid

public void setBoardBpSid(long boardBpSid)
Parameters:
boardBpSid -

getBoardBackUpVO

public BoardBackUpVO getBoardBackUpVO()
Returns:

setBoardBackUpVO

public void setBoardBackUpVO(BoardBackUpVO boardBackUpVO)
Parameters:
boardBackUpVO -